Sound design can elevate collectible items from mere icons to immersive gateways. The core idea is to marry tactile in-game objects with a sonic footprint that nudges players toward discovery without breaking immersion. Start by defining a distinct auditory signature for each collectible, one that remains recognizable across environments. Layering subtle environmental ambiances with crisp, unique tones creates a sonic fingerprint players can learn. Encourage players to listen for context clues—changes in tempo, rhythmic patterns, or faint melodies that appear when near a secret area. This approach rewards attentive players and seeds curiosity, turning exploration into an evolving auditory puzzle rather than a simple fetch quest.
When implementing sound-based collectibles, balance is essential. Too loud or too frequent cues can feel like handholding, while too faint cues risk player frustration. A practical method is to tie audio hints to in-game actions that align with the world’s logic: movement through a specific material, interaction with a rare object, or time-based events that reveal layered chimes. Ensure hints scale with player progression; novices get gentle prompts, veterans receive nuanced variations. Craft audio cues to be learnable yet not trivial—repetition should refine a player’s intuition instead of revealing solutions outright. Accessibility considerations, including subtitle cues and adjustable audio levels, broaden the design’s reach.
Subtly teach players to listen and learn the world’s hidden grammar.
The first step in designing a collectible that uses sound to unlock secrets is to define the map-like logic of the world. Establish how sound travels through different materials and spaces, and build a catalog of cues that interact with those properties. For example, a brass whistle tone that grows louder near copper walls or an echoing chime that only activates after a player completes a sequence of actions. By mapping audio behaviors to spatial layouts, designers can craft consistent yet surprising encounters that feel earned. Players learn through trial and repetition, forming a mental model of where to expect a secret without explicit directions.

Crafting the mechanics behind the clues requires careful layering. Consider combining multiple subtle signals that only coalesce when the player has performed the right sequence or explored the correct region. A successful system might employ a primary cue indicating proximity, a secondary cue suggesting the exact path, and a tertiary cue that confirms the reveal. This orchestration keeps players engaged longer, as they piece together how sounds interlock with the environment. Always test with people who are new to the game texture; their fresh reactions reveal whether the audio clues feel natural or contrived. Balancing novelty with predictability sustains long-term curiosity.
Players hear clues; the world responds with meaningful resonance.
Momentum matters in audio challenges, and pacing can be as important as the notes themselves. Alternate between quiet, almost imperceptible hints and louder milestones to create a heartbeat that guides players through the journey. A rising series of soft percussive elements can signal progress, while a sudden, sparse jingle marks a pivotal moment. The timing should feel organic, never abrupt, so players perceive it as part of the world’s fabric rather than a scoring mechanic. If the cadence aligns with the game’s tempo, players’ ears become attuned to the environment, turning listening into cognitive habit rather than optional flair.

Visual and sonic cues should be synchronized to reinforce discovery. Design visuals that echo the audio language—color shifts, texture changes, or particle patterns that appear as hints when a collectible is approached. This cross-modal consistency helps players form a more robust map in their minds. Ensure that audio cues remain legible in visually busy scenes by adjusting their spectral content or employing ducking techniques during important dialogues. The end goal is a harmonious blend where hearing informs seeing, and seeing corroborates hearing, creating a cohesive discovery experience.
Silence can speak as powerfully as sound when used with intention.
Beyond discovery, audio-rich collectibles can teach players about game systems in a natural, unobtrusive way. The soundscape can encode rules—timing windows for interactions, resource costs inferred from tone, or risk-reward signals embedded in a motif. Design these echoes so that players gradually infer mechanics through listening, not through explicit handholding. A well-crafted system rewards experimentation: if a tone alters when attempting a tricky jump or a stealth section, players learn the optimal moment to act. The acoustic feedback becomes a silent tutor, shaping behavior without overt instruction and deepening immersion.
To maintain freshness, rotate the palette of cues over time. Introduce new instruments, motifs, or layering techniques as players uncover more secrets. This keeps the experience evolving and prevents auditory fatigue. It’s also wise to vary the complexity of clues across regions or modes, so early zones teach basics while later areas challenge more seasoned players. Documented playtesting sessions can reveal where cues feel intuitive and where they become ambiguous. Use that data to prune extraneous sounds, sharpen transitions, and ensure each new collectible carries a distinct but related sonic signature.

Silence, strategically employed, can heighten the impact of a hidden mechanic. A deliberate pause before a satisfying reveal can make the final clue feel earned and memorable. When used sparingly, silence invites players to lean into their environment and listen more closely, rewarding patience. Pair silent moments with visual cues that hint at what lies ahead, so players don’t lose momentum. The craft lies in knowing when quiet can amplify rather than dampen engagement. By balancing noise and stillness, designers create a dynamic rhythm that mirrors the explorer’s journey, encouraging careful listening as a core skill.
Finally, consider the social dimension of audio collectibles. Players often compare notes, exchange theories, or stream their discoveries. Providing shared sonic experiences—ripples of the same motif across play sessions or community-driven remixes—can deepen engagement. In multiplayer settings, ensure that audio cues remain legible when several players are present, avoiding feedback loops or sound masking. Encouraging collaboration around listening tasks can transform a solitary scavenger hunt into a communal puzzle. Thoughtful design of these sounds can extend a game’s lifespan, turning every session into a new audition of discovery.
The lore embedded in audio collectibles should feel intrinsic to the world’s history. Each cue can reflect a faction, era, or narrative beat, giving players a reason to collect beyond rewards. When a sound carries story weight, it becomes a breadcrumb that users pursue for more context, not just perhaps a prize. Build a catalog that maps audio identities to world-building elements, then weave these threads into quests or environmental storytelling. The result is a richer experience where players collect to learn, understand, and connect with the setting on a deeper level.
As development progresses, document decisions about why certain sounds exist and how they guide play. A living design document helps future teams preserve the intended rhythm and avoids diluting the system with arbitrary audio. Embrace iterative testing, gather feedback from diverse players, and stay open to remixes that may reveal better sonic economies. The payoff is a durable, evergreen mechanic: sound as a reliable navigator, guiding players to hidden corners, secret rooms, and the subtle rules that govern a vibrant, interactive world.
